Bloomington’s free upskilling program is back for another session! Please help us spread the word!
The spring 2022 Code/IT Academy prepares students to take the CompTIA Security+ certification exam. CompTIA Security+ establishes the core knowledge required of any cybersecurity role and provides a springboard to intermediate-level cybersecurity jobs. CompTIA Security+ validates the baseline skills necessary to perform core security functions and pursue an IT security career. For this 10-week session, students need to have a basic understanding of computer systems and network infrastructure either through previous classwork or job experience. Sessions are in-person, Tuesday and Thursdays, 5:30-7:30 pm, here at The Mill.
Code/IT Academy is completely free. Access to laptops is provided as needed, and the cost of the exam is covered, too.
